Web27 jan. 2024 · The earliest recorded cat that lived for over 30 years is Puss the tabby cat. He lived from 1903 to 1939, living a total of 36 years and 1 day. Another cat’s age that was documented during this period is Ma. Ma is a Domestic Shorthair that was born in 1923 and lived for 34 years and 5 months. Both Puss and Ma lived in the United Kingdom. Web24 aug. 2024 · Cats cannot go more than a few days without food and water because their liver is not made to support their bodies for long living off their body’s energy stores alone. If your cat has not eaten for more than two days, you should reach out to your vet for their expertise. A physical exam can help determine why your cat is skipping meal time ...
